    Letsile Responds Following Relays Withdrawal

    Published on

    spot_img

    I acknowledge the official statement issued by the Botswana Athletics Association regarding my withdrawal from the men’s 4x400m relay team for the upcoming 2025 World Athletics Relays.

    I wish to clarify that my withdrawal was not a decision taken lightly, nor without due consideration and engagement with relevant stakeholders. As stated, a personal decision was made in the best interest of all parties involved, and in full alignment with my long-term goals as a professional athlete. I remain fully committed to my country, the team, and the advancement of athletics in Botswana. As always, I remain proud to represent Botswana on the world stage and urge the nation to rally behind the team with the same energy and spirit that defines us as Batswana.

    To my fans and stakeholders, I sincerely apologize for missing the opportunity to compete at the World Relays. Your unwavering support means the world to me, and I am deeply grateful for your understanding.
    Be assured that my schedule for the season remains unchanged.
